1st Annual Drive for Food Golf Tournament

Charlottetown, PEI, August 6th, 2007 - The Men's Club of Ss. Peter and Paul Orthodox Church in Charlottetown will be hosting the First Annual Drive for Food Golf Tournament, Saturday, September 15th at Glen Afton Golf Course with a tee off time of 1pm.

Co-Chairs for the tournament are David Mackenzie and Nasser Saad. David MacKenzie, Sub-Deacon of Ss. Peter & Paul Orthodox Church, welcomes everyone to attend saying, "We are very excited to be hosting our first Golf Tournament and happy that we can offer half of the proceeds from the tournament as a donation to the Upper Room Food Ministry."

Nasser Saad, stated, "The hole in one prize for the 17th hole is a new 4 door 5 speed Honda Civic car from Capital Honda, plus there will be other prizes to win"

The tournament format will be a four person team, best ball scramble format, with a meal hosted by Chef Kenny Zakem following the completion of the tournament. The cost will be $30/person for Glen Afton Members and $45 per person for non-members.

There will be individual hole sponsorships available at a cost of $100 per hole with the sponsor receiving a sign posted at the tee off point as well as their name listed in the thank you bulletin sent to all participants at the end of the tournament.

Ss Peter & Paul Antiochian Orthodox Church is a Church of the Antiochian Orthodox Archdiocese of North America, established in 1994 with the blessing of His Eminence Metropolitan PHILIP and His Grace Bishop ANTOUN. Antiochian Orthodox Christian Archdiocese of North America are the jurisdiction of the Orthodox Christian Church whose roots trace directly back to first century Antioch, the city in which the disciples of Jesus Christ were first called "Christians" (Acts 11:26).
